Razor blades found in anti-mask/vaccination posters
Read an important safety message…
Public Health England has told us about incidents of razor blades being stuck to the back of anti-mask/vaccination posters. See the report from Suffolk.
Do not attempt to remove any such posters unless you have the appropriate tools and protective gloves. If you don’t, report it to someone that does.
If you suspect a razor blade is present, or one is found upon removal, please:
- inform the police by calling 101
- report it as per the CCG’s incident reporting procedure
- email the Communications team.
